- /*
- * Power button driver for the SGI O2 and Octane.
- */
- int power_intr(void *);
- struct cfdriver power_cd = {
- NULL, "power", DV_DULL
- };
- #if NPOWER_MACEBUS > 0
- #include <sgi/localbus/macebusvar.h>
- void power_macebus_attach(struct device *, struct device *, void *);
- int power_macebus_match(struct device *, void *, void *);
- struct cfattach power_macebus_ca = {
- sizeof(struct device), power_macebus_match, power_macebus_attach
- };
- int
- power_macebus_match(struct device *parent, void *match, void *aux)
- {
- return (1);
- }
- void
- power_macebus_attach(struct device *parent, struct device *self, void *aux)
- {
- struct macebus_attach_args *maa = aux;
- /* Establish interrupt handler. */
- if (macebus_intr_establish(maa->maa_intr, maa->maa_mace_intr,
- IST_EDGE, IPL_TTY, power_intr, self, self->dv_xname))
- printf("\n");
- else
- printf(": unable to establish interrupt!\n");
- }
- #endif
- #if NPOWER_MAINBUS > 0
- #include <sgi/xbow/xbow.h>
- #include <sgi/xbow/xheartreg.h>
- void power_mainbus_attach(struct device *, struct device *, void *);
- int power_mainbus_match(struct device *, void *, void *);
- int power_mainbus_intr(void *);
- struct cfattach power_mainbus_ca = {
- sizeof(struct device), power_mainbus_match, power_mainbus_attach
- };
- int
- power_mainbus_match(struct device *parent, void *match, void *aux)
- {
- struct mainbus_attach_args *maa = aux;
- if (strcmp(maa->maa_name, power_cd.cd_name) != 0)
- return 0;
- return sys_config.system_type == SGI_OCTANE ? 1 : 0;
- }
- void
- power_mainbus_attach(struct device *parent, struct device *self, void *aux)
- {
- /* Establish interrupt handler. */
- if (xbow_intr_establish(power_mainbus_intr, self, HEART_ISR_POWER,
- IPL_TTY, self->dv_xname, NULL) != 0) {
- printf(": unable to establish interrupt!\n");
- return;
- }
- printf("\n");
- }
- int
- power_mainbus_intr(void *v)
- {
- /*
- * Clear interrupt condition; debouncing the kickstart bit will not
- * suffice.
- */
- xbow_intr_clear(HEART_ISR_POWER);
- return power_intr(v);
- }
- #endif
- int
- power_intr(void *unused)
- {
- extern int allowpowerdown;
- int val;
- /*
- * Prevent further interrupts by clearing the kickstart flag
- * in the DS1687's extended control register.
- */
- val = dsrtc_register_read(DS1687_EXT_CTRL);
- if (val == -1)
- return 1; /* no rtc attached */
- /* debounce condition */
- dsrtc_register_write(DS1687_EXT_CTRL, val & ~DS1687_KICKSTART);
- if (allowpowerdown == 1) {
- allowpowerdown = 0;
- prsignal(initprocess, SIGUSR2);
- }
- return 1;
- }
